From Traditional to Digital: A Historical Perspective

Traditional banking involved customers visiting a physical branch to carry out transactions, such as deposits, withdrawals, and loan applications. However, with the advent of technology, banks began to offer online banking services, which allowed customers to access their accounts and perform transactions from anywhere at any time.

In recent years, digital banking has taken center stage, with banks leveraging technology to offer a range of innovative services, such as mobile banking, digital wallets, and robo-advisory services. Digital banking has not only made banking more convenient for customers but has also enabled banks to reduce costs and improve efficiency.

Current Trends in Digital Banking

The digital transformation of the banking industry is ongoing, and several trends are shaping the future of digital banking. One of the most significant trends is the use of art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ning (ML) in banking. AI-powered chatbots are being used by banks to offer personalized customer service, while ML algorithms are being used to detect fraud and manage risk.

Another trend is the use of blockchain technology in banking. Blockchain technology offers a secure and transparent way to carry out transactions, and several banks are exploring its potential for cross-border payments and other financial services.

Finally, open banking is another trend that is gaining momentum in the banking industry. Open banking involves opening up banks’ data and services to third-party providers, enabling customers to access a range of financial services from different providers through a single platform.

Data Analytics and Risk Management

As the banking industry continues to evolve, data analytics and risk management have become increasingly important. With the help of AI, banks can now use predictive analytics to identify patterns in customer behavior and make more informed decisions.

Predictive Analytics in Banking

Predictive analytics is a powerful tool that can help banks identify potential risks and opportunities before they become a problem. By analyzing large amounts of data, banks can gain insights into customer behavior and preferences, as well as identify potential fraud. This can help banks make more informed decisions about lending and investment, as well as improve customer service.

For example, banks can use predictive analytics to analyze credit card transactions and identify potentially fraudulent activity. By analyzing patterns in spending behavior, banks can identify transactions that are outside of the norm and flag them for further investigation. This can help banks prevent fraud and protect their customers from financial loss.

Risk Assessment and Fraud Detection

Risk assessment and fraud detection are two key areas where AI is having a significant impact on the banking industry. By using machine learning algorithms to analyze large amounts of data, banks can identify potential risks and take proactive measures to mitigate them.

For example, banks can use AI to analyze customer data and identify potential risks associated with lending or investment. By analyzing factors such as credit history, income, and spending behavior, banks can identify customers who may be at a higher risk of defaulting on a loan or investment. This can help banks make more informed decisions about lending and investment, as well as reduce the risk of financial loss.

In addition, AI can also be used to detect and prevent fraud. By analyzing patterns in transaction data, banks can identify potential fraudulent activity and take proactive measures to prevent it. This can help banks protect their customers from financial loss and maintain the integrity of their financial systems.

Security, Privacy, and Ethical Considerations

As digital banking continues to evolve, security, privacy, and ethical considerations remain a top priority for financial institutions. With the rise of AI-powered financial services, it is crucial to ensure that customer data is protected, bias is mitigated, and fairness is ensured.

Protecting Customer Data

One of the most significant concerns in digital banking is the protection of personal data. Financial institutions must ensure that customer data is protected from unauthorized access, use, or disclosure. This includes implementing robust security measures such as encryption, access controls, and monitoring systems.

In addition, financial institutions must comply with relevant regulations such as the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) and the California Consumer Privacy Act (CCPA) to protect customer data. Failure to comply with these regulations can lead to severe penalties, loss of customer trust, and reputational damage.

Mitigating Bias and Ensuring Fairness

AI-powered financial services have the potential to improve efficiency, accuracy, and customer experience. However, they also pose a risk of bias and discrimination. Financial institutions must ensure that their AI systems are designed and implemented in a way that mitigates bias and ensures fairness.

To achieve this, financial institutions can use techniques such as algorithmic transparency, explainability, and testing to detect and mitigate bias. They can also ensure that their AI systems are trained on diverse and representative data sets to avoid bias in decision-making.
